Aston Villa vs Chelsea Club Predictions, Picks & Odds for March 4, 2026

Moumita Dutta

Aston Villa will welcome Chelsea to Villa Park on Wednesday, March 4, 2026. The Premier League fixture carries major implications in the race for a top-five finish. Villa are reeling from a 2-0 defeat to Wolves. Whereas Chelsea are coming into the match after a narrow 2-1 loss to Arsenal.

In that clash, they conceded twice from set pieces. With just six points separating these sides in the standings, this is effectively a four-pointer in the Champions League qualification battle. And both managers are navigating key injuries and defensive vulnerabilities going into the match.

Best Bet for Aston Villa vs Chelsea

Our best bet for Aston Villa vs Chelsea is Both Teams to Score: Yes at -185 (BetMGM) / -176 (FanDuel).

Across their last 10 Premier League matches, Villa have conceded in seven while scoring in eight. They’re averaging approximately 1.6 xG per game but allowing close to 1.4 xGA in that stretch. The absence of Boubacar Kamara has disrupted midfield protection. Meanwhile, without Levi Colwill available for Chelsea. 

So, both back lines have shown vulnerabilities. Chelsea’s previous three league matches have all featured goals at both ends. They generated over 1.5 xG at the Emirates yet conceded twice from dead-ball situations. Cole Palmer continues to average over two key passes per 90. 

Ollie Watkins netted twice in the reverse fixture and thrives against high defensive lines. But Chelsea are potent in away games as they’ve scored at least one goal in five of their last six road games. Given such away scoring trend from Chelsea and Villa’s home attacking consistency, the match should see goals on both ends.

Aston Villa vs Chelsea Prediction

Our pick: Chelsea to Win at +150 (BetMGM) / +150 (FanDuel)

Despite failing to win their last three league games (two draws and a defeat), contextual stats show that they’ve averaged nearly 2.0 xG across those fixtures. Their finishing variance, not chance creation, has limited returns. Villa, meanwhile, have won only once in their last five league matches. 

They’re sitting 13 points off the summit. In that span, they’ve conceded nine goals and allowed multiple big chances in four games. The midfield absence of Youri Tielemans reduces progressive passing options. John McGinn’s uncertain availability further narrows rotation. 

Villa claimed the reverse fixture 2-1 at Stamford Bridge this season. But Chelsea’s away record under Liam Rosenior includes three wins in their last five road league outings. With Pedro Neto suspended yet Wesley Fofana returning, the defensive structure should stabilize and even through a fight, Chelsea should sail through.

Trends to Know for Aston Villa vs Chelsea

  • Recent Form: Villa have one win in five league matches, conceding nine goals in that run. Chelsea are winless in three but have created strong chances  despite defensive lapses.
  • Reverse Fixture: Villa won 2-1 at Stamford Bridge in December, with Ollie Watkins exploiting space behind Chelsea’s back line.
  • Home vs Away: Villa have scored in eight of their last nine home league matches. Chelsea have netted in five of their last six away fixtures.
  • Set-Piece Vulnerability: Chelsea conceded twice from set plays against Arsenal, while Villa have allowed multiple second-ball opportunities in recent weeks.
  • Injury Impact: Kamara’s season-ending knee injury weakens Villa’s defensive screen. Chelsea remain without Levi Colwill long-term.
